We live in a world directed at small, handheld screens that isolate us. We are hungry for and require a sense of community. In this busy, hectic world, how can we help build the community people so desperately need? The answers to building community may be quirkier and produce more wonder and attention than you think. Selecting unique programming and ideal locations can build lasting bonds. This workshop will review in-person and virtual tools to bring people together.
